Audible Alarms and UPS Conditions
The UPS has an audible alarm feature to alert you of potential power
problems. Use Table 9 to determine and resolve the UPS alarms and
conditions.

Silencing an Audible Alarm
Before silencing an alarm, check the alarm condition and perform the
applicable action to resolve the condition (see Table 9). To silence the
alarm for an existing fault, press the
button. If UPS status changes,
the alarm beeps, overriding the previous alarm silencing.
